Based on a comparison of 158 countries in 2013, China ranked the highest in vegetable consumption per capita with 328 kg followed by Armenia and Montenegro. According to a detailed study conducted by the Centers for Disease Control, only 2% of high school students in the US meet the vegetable consumption levels recommended by health experts. The countries with the highest levels of cabbage per capita consumption in 2018 were Romania (57 kg per person), South Korea (46 kg per person) and Ukraine (39 kg per person). A 91g of raw broccoli supplies your body with 116% of its required daily intake of vitamin K and 135% of its vitamin C daily needs, alongside a substantial amount of potassium, magnesium, and folate.
